The Market
For those who serve the maritime industry, it comes as not surprise that the owners are facing a severe crew shortage; it has been talked about for years and yet it is only now we are seeing anyone do anything about it. This includes looking for ways to get and keep crew at sea, byt giving them some of the things they are used to at home like the internet and the ability to email and stay in touch at a reasonable cost. OpenPort brings this closer to reality.
The other demand in the industry today is for the ships to be treated more like a connection to the office. This requires a faster connection at a price that is more commercial. We believe OpenPort is priced right.
Why OpenPort?
Iridium OpenPort is the right size to fit on almost any vessel; it is only 0.5m in diameter and weighs about 10kgs. This means any vessel over 50 feet will have no trouble fitting this to the deck.
OpenPort is packaged with very competitive bundles of voice and data enabling the industry to deal with the two market demands: crew satisfaction and business communications.
Markets
The OpenPort is ideal for every market segment. Large ships, deep sea, coasters, tugs, fishing, and luxury yachts all have a need for this product. It can be used as either the primary communications hardware or as the back-up hardware.
The cost/value tradeoff is much more attractive with the OpenPort. The speed is up to 128kps and this is more than sufficient for most ship owners; however those who want more are going to have to pay significantly more for other systems, both in terms of hardware and airtime.
